Definition

  1. 1
    Suficientemente inusual o no habitual para que cause algún grado de sorpresa.
  2. 2
    Que ya no se usa.

Recorded use

Wiktionary examples

These source excerpts show how inusitado appears in context. They illustrate usage; the definition above remains the entry’s reference meaning.

  1. Su último eslogan tuvo un éxito inusitado en las redes sociales.
  2. Era curioso, pero la sensación de que mi mente había trabajado con un rigor férreo me daba una energía inusitada: me sentía fuerte, estaba poseído por una decisión viril y dispuse de todo.
